FreeCAD MCP Server

A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that enables AI assistants to interact with FreeCAD for 3D modeling and CAD operations.

Features

- Basic Geometry Creation: Create boxes, cylinders, spheres with specified dimensions
- Boolean Operations: Perform union, cut, and common operations between objects
- Document Management: Save documents and list objects
- Custom Script Execution: Execute arbitrary Python scripts in FreeCAD context
- Cross-Platform: Supports Windows, macOS, and Linux

Prerequisites

1. FreeCAD Installation: Install FreeCAD from freecad.org
2. Node.js: Version 18 or higher
3. TypeScript: For development

Installation

1. Clone this repository:

git clone https://github.com/lucygoodchild/freecad-mcp-server.git
cd freecad-mcp-server

2. Install dependencies:

npm install

3. Build the project:

npm run build

4. Configure FreeCAD path (if needed):
- The server attempts to auto-detect FreeCAD installation
- Default paths:
- Windows: C:\Program Files\FreeCAD 0.21\bin\FreeCAD.exe
- macOS: /Applications/FreeCAD.app/Contents/MacOS/FreeCAD
- Linux: /usr/bin/freecad

Usage

Running the Server

npm start

Claude Desktop

Add the following to your MCP client configuration (~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json): { "mcpServers": { "freecad-mcp-server": { "command": "node", "args": ["/path/to/free-cad-mcp/build/index.js"] } } } Make sure to replace "/path/to/free-cad-mcp/build/index.js" with the actual path and to restart Claude once you have made the changes

Available Tools

create_box

Create a rectangular box with specified dimensions.
{
  "name": "create_box",
  "arguments": {
    "length": 50,
    "width": 30,
    "height": 20,
    "name": "MyBox"
  }
}

create_cylinder

Create a cylinder with specified radius and height.
{
  "name": "create_cylinder", 
  "arguments": {
    "radius": 10,
    "height": 50,
    "name": "MyCylinder"
  }
}

create_sphere

Create a sphere with specified radius.
{
  "name": "create_sphere",
  "arguments": {
    "radius": 15,
    "name": "MySphere"
  }
}

boolean_operation

Perform boolean operations between two objects.
{
  "name": "boolean_operation",
  "arguments": {
    "operation": "union",
    "object1": "Box",
    "object2": "Cylinder",
    "result_name": "Combined"
  }
}

Operations: union, cut, common

save_document

Save the current FreeCAD document.
{
  "name": "save_document",
  "arguments": {
    "filename": "my_model.FCStd",
    "path": "/path/to/save"
  }
}

list_objects

List all objects in the current document.
{
  "name": "list_objects",
  "arguments": {}
}

execute_python_script

Execute custom Python script in FreeCAD context.
{
  "name": "execute_python_script",
  "arguments": {
    "script": "box = doc.addObject('Part::Box', 'CustomBox')\nbox.Length = 100"
  }
}

Integration with AI Assistants

This server implements the Model Context Protocol, making it compatible with MCP-enabled AI assistants. The AI can:

1. Generate 3D Models: Create complex geometries by combining basic shapes
2. Parametric Design: Modify dimensions and parameters based on requirements
3. Assembly Creation: Build multi-part assemblies using boolean operations
4. Design Automation: Execute complex modeling workflows through scripting

Troubleshooting

FreeCAD Not Found

- Verify FreeCAD is installed and accessible from command line - Update the freecadPath in the server constructor if needed - Check that the FreeCAD executable has proper permissions

Script Execution Errors

- Ensure FreeCAD Python environment has required modules - Check script syntax - Python scripts are executed in FreeCAD's Python interpreter - Use list_objects to verify object names before boolean operations
